This is an attempt to followup on something Jakub asked me about [1], adding an xsk attribute to queues and more clearly documenting which queues are linked to NAPIs... After the RFC [2], Jakub suggested creating an empty nest for queues which have a pool, so I've adjusted this version to work that way. The nest can be extended in the future to express attributes about XSK as needed. Queues which are not used for AF_XDP do not have the xsk attribute present.
